Review summary

Created with AI, based on recent reviews

Considering 499 reviews, most reviewers were let down by their experience overall. Many consumers noted that the goods received did not match the advertised pictures, often consisting of cheap or poorly made materials. Reviewers frequently mentioned issues with the quality of the items, describing fabrics as synthetic or the products themselves as shabby. However, some people mentioned that the refund was processed quickly once the return was sent. Conversely, a small portion of people felt that the returns process was a major hurdle, requiring customers to ship items to Canada at their own expense. Some reviewers also pointed out significant problems with sizing, noting items were often too small despite size designations.

Rated 1 out of 5 stars

Confirmed order not received but refused refund. Drop-shipping scam.

My order was not delivered due to damage in transit. Lune "London" (actually Canada, Netherlands & China) refused my request to cancel (I needed the item for my holiday the following week and wouldn't be in the country to accept delivery).
Instead, they insisted on replacing the order without my consent.
This replacement order still hasn't arrived, four weeks later. Lune London admits I have not received it and it is 'somewhere' with the courier - despite Yodel's system saying it was handed to me in person when I was 3,000 miles away.
Lune London is insisting I deal with the original drop-shipper CNE Express in China myself to locate the parcel, which is a serious breach of the UK Consumer Rights Act 2015. The parcel is Lune London's responsibility until received by the consumer and that includes dealing with courier issues.
They have offered me vouchers or yet another replacement, but refused a refund, despite having failed to fulfil the contract twice now. So a refund is my legal right.
I'm now heading to a credit card chargeback.
Glossy, credible website, but these guys are drop-shipping scammers.
